Transponder Keys

The transponder key is a car key with a specific microchip in it. The chip transmits radio frequency codes to the ignition immobilizer in your vehicle so that it can start when the key is close enough. The chips are usually incorporated inside the key's plastic but some cars include them inside a small key-fob.

If you lose a transponder key you'll have to get it replaced through the dealership for your car. The process will take several days and may require that you bring your vehicle to be towed and have proof of ownership documents with you. The dealer will then need to electronically pair the new chip to your car's system, which could cost anywhere from $200 to $250.

If you're looking for an easy and cost-effective solution, consider getting your replacement key through an auto locksmith. These specialists will be able to cut you an entirely new key and program it for your specific vehicle. They'll also be able erase the old key from your car's system.

If you are calling to replace your car keys, it is best to have the year, make, and model of the key for your car with you. This will allow the technician to determine the kind of car keys you require and how much it will cost.

Remote Keys

If your key fob isn't working there could be a number of issues. The most frequent are broken battery contacts or buttons that aren't working. If you're able to change the batteries, but they aren't working, the issue may be in your vehicle itself. Check your vehicle's manual before making any repairs or buying a new remote to see whether it has specific instructions on how to solve fob issues.
